Decay-out properties of a linked superdeformed band in 84Zr

Journal Article · · Physical Review C

Three discrete transitions were observed between the yrast superdeformed (SD) band and states of normal deformation (ND) in the nucleus {sup 84}Zr. This is the first observation of such linking transitions in the mass-80 SD region. The properties of the decay out of the SD well in {sup 84}Zr are compared with those in other SD mass regions. Calculations suggest that there is extensive mixing of configurations in the SD and ND potential minima, leading to an abrupt and highly fragmented decay-out process. A study of least-action tunneling paths indicates that the potential barrier separating the SD and ND wells is very small.
